MERJE are partnered with a Financial Services business with a focus on Asset Finance. They require a talented Finance Manager to lead the finance team, build processes and routines, develop financial reporting and insights, and act as an advisor to the Finance Leadership team.

Our ideal candidate will have hands-on experience of Finance routines from a lending background, with an appreciation of current accounting standards and tax legislation. You will be highly motivated, with an enquiring mind and passion to help the business grow and develop by building and maintaining effective Finance routines and discipline. Their business is starting to automate their Finance processes so you will ideally have experience of, or had exposure to, an automation project.

Key Responsibilities

  • Help set out and deliver Management accounting and finance processes and routines
  • Maintain and evolve key financial control processes to ensure the integrity of financial information
  • Manage processes to ensure that the business remains complaint with current and future Financial standards, including engagement with Auditors
  • Lead the development of financial reporting to provide the management team and board of Directors with insightful views on financial performance
  • Act as a partner and advisor to the leadership team – helping to drive an understanding of business performance, financial reporting (inc. regulatory) and tax issues
  • Close collaboration with Operational Managers and Group functions
  • Focus on the development of people and future leaders by providing training, coaching and mentoring to the Finance teams

Experience Requirements

  • Proven experience of managing a Finance team and coordinating key month-end and reporting routines
  • Clear understanding of the importance of maintaining and developing key controls and checks to ensure the integrity of financial reporting
  • Demonstrates an understanding of Accounting Standards and tax treatment in a lending firm
  • Experience of developing Finance processes and leading change
  • Knowledge of Asset Finance products and processes (not essential)

Skills

  • Qualified accountant with experience within a lending business
  • Dynamic, technically strong and able to operate with gravitas across the organisation
  • Control mindset with an understanding of risk and building effective finance controls
  • Problem solver, understanding the root-causes of issues and able to drive solutions
  • Integrity, openness and commitment to good governance
  • Passion for working as part of a team and collaborating to achieve greater results
